Output de52891bf406d7dda24664208ce86d58928950d85b22ec3f0b16c4e52d8ae2f6:0

value
3382733100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0510e1f1ffafb96be2295188b358c9ff5ee4a581 OP_EQUAL
address
M8MwqQuABmZzuMaKP7jDP9g5UUNKobFusd
transaction
de52891bf406d7dda24664208ce86d58928950d85b22ec3f0b16c4e52d8ae2f6
spent
true